In /etc/init.d/dnsmasq, i suggest to replace
DNSMASQ_OPTS="$DNSMASQ_OPTS `sed -e s/". IN DS "/--trust-anchor=.,/ -e
s/" "/,/g $ROOT_DS | tr '\n' ' '`"
by
DNSMASQ_OPTS="$DNSMASQ_OPTS `sed -e s/".\s*\d*\sIN DS
"/--trust-anchor=.,/ -e s/" "/,/g $ROOT_DS | tr '\n' ' '`"
